State Rep. Malcolm Kenyatta now has a clear path to being re-elected as a Democratic National Committee vice chairman after activist David Hogg withdrew from the race. Hogg pulled out of the race on Wednesday after the DNC approved a subcommittee’s recommendation that the vice chair vote in February be tabled and a new election held after a female candidate complained about procedural errors in the vote.

Axios on MSNDNC votes to oust David Hogg and Malcolm KenyattaDNC members voted Wednesday to vacate the elections of DNC vice chairs David Hogg and Malcolm Kenyatta. Why it matters: The vote was based on a technical complaint, but it comes as Democrats have expressed fury with Hogg for simultaneously serving as a top party official while supporting congressional primary candidates.
The Democratic National Committee has voted to hold new elections for two vice chair positions currently held by David Hogg and Malcolm Kenyatta and Hogg said he will not participate.
